161.50
price up icon0.12%   0.19
after-market After Hours: 161.50
loading

Why is Balchem Corp (BCPC) Stock down?

27 Oct, 2023:

Shares of Balchem Corporation (BCPC) dropped by 5.42% from $121.68 to $115.08 in the trading on Friday, October 27, 2023. The reason why BCPC stock down is due to the company's week third-quarter 2023 earnings report.

  • Earnings: The company reported earnings of $0.90 per share, missing the expected $0.91 per share and falling short of last year's $0.78 per share.
  • Revenue: Balchem, part of the Zacks Chemical - Specialty industry, reported $229.95 million in revenues for the quarter ending in September 2023, missing the consensus estimate by 3.57% compared to $244.27 million the previous year.
specialty_chemicals WLK
$91.85
price up icon 1.69%
specialty_chemicals RPM
$103.15
price down icon 0.02%
specialty_chemicals LYB
$56.77
price up icon 1.48%
specialty_chemicals IFF
$72.50
price up icon 2.03%
specialty_chemicals PPG
$100.05
price up icon 1.66%
specialty_chemicals DD
$60.14
price up icon 1.50%
Cap:     |  Volume (24h):